The UR 501 Jawbone: A Central African Enigma

The UR 501 jawbone, discovered in Malawi, is a fascinating find. Estimated to be around 2.5 to 2.3 million years old, it belongs to the Homo rudolfensis group, an early human relative. What makes this discovery significant is its location. Early Homo fossils had not been found in Central Africa before, suggesting that early humans or their close relatives may have moved through the East African rift system. This finding offers crucial clues about how early Homo spread across the continent, challenging our understanding of human migration patterns.

Lomekwi Stone Tools: The Ancient Artisans

The Lomekwi stone tools, discovered in West Turkana, Kenya, are around 3.3 million years old. They are considered the oldest known tools ever found, and their discovery changed the idea that toolmaking was only a human trait. These tools, including anvils, cores, and flakes, were likely made by early human relatives such as Australopithecus or Kenyanthropus. This finding suggests that toolmaking may have evolved earlier than previously thought, with potential implications for our understanding of cognitive development and cultural practices.

Lake Zaysan: The Ancient Lake of Kazakhstan

Lake Zaysan, believed to be around 65 million years old, is a fascinating natural wonder. While Lake Baikal is often called the world's oldest lake, Lake Zaysan may be even older. The lake is thought to have formed during the Cretaceous period, though its exact age is difficult to confirm. Today, it is located near artificial reservoirs and the Bukhtarma dam, which has raised the lake's water level, increasing its area and causing some sources to group it with nearby reservoirs.

Makhonjwa Mountains: The Ancient Mountains of South Africa and Eswatini

The Makhonjwa Mountains, located in South Africa and Eswatini, are about 3.6 billion years old. They are widely known as the oldest mountain range in the world, and for good reason. The mountains are part of the Barberton Greenstone Belt, one of Earth's oldest geological structures. They also contain some of the oldest known signs of life and ancient gold deposits, making them a treasure trove of geological and biological history.

Stromatolites: The Ancient Records of Life

Stromatolites are layered rock structures formed by ancient cyanobacteria. Some of the oldest stromatolites are about 3.5 billion years old, making them among the earliest visible evidence of life on Earth. These organisms once existed in large numbers around the planet, and although they became less common in the fossil record about a billion years ago, stromatolites still grow in some places today. They remain one of the clearest records of early life, offering a window into the conditions and processes that gave rise to life on our planet.

Hematite Tubes: The Ancient Fossils of Quebec

Hematite tubes found in Quebec, Canada, may be between 3.7 and 4.2 billion years old. Researchers have suggested that these tiny structures could be some of the oldest fossils ever discovered. The tubes resemble structures made by modern microbes near hydrothermal vents, and they contain chemical signs often linked with life, including carbon and phosphorus. However, some scientists remain cautious, arguing that the structures may have been misread or may not be as old as claimed.

Jack Hills Zircon: The Ancient Crystals of Australia

The Jack Hills zircon crystals from Australia are believed to be the oldest known material found on Earth, dating to about 4.375 billion years old. These tiny crystals formed only around 165 million years after Earth itself, and their chemistry suggests that early Earth may have cooled quickly enough to have surface water and continental-type rocks. That means the young planet may not have been as hostile as once believed.
